With seven techniques and 101 patterns, this how-to book provides detailed, clear instructions for knitting and crocheting colorful and artful socks. These projects cover a wide range of skill sets, from the beginner to the advanced knitter. You'll learn, among other things, how to create sock heels in three different styles, knit with circular needles, knit from the toe up, and create felted textiles using your washing machine. A how-to primer on sock making is included for beginners, and size tables help you create socks that fit perfectly for all ages. Various sock styles include cable, stripe, and rainbow patterns, socks with fringe, pompons, and other embellishments, sport socks, slippers, socks with a "lodge" look, and even a dolphin motif.

Whether you knit them toe-up or top-down, getting just the right fit on hand knit socks can be a major challenge! In Custom Socks, Kate Atherley sets out to teach knitters of all levels the skills and tools they need to understand sock fit, and to knit a pair of socks that fit properly. She calls on her years of experience as Knitty's Managing Technical Editor, where she has edited hundreds of sock patterns, to share this information in a way that is easy to understand with patterns that inspire.
